一种基于802.11e动态自适应调整竞争窗口的算法*

摘    要:为了进一步改善高负载状况下服务质量的性能,在原有的IEEE 802.11e 增强型分布式协调功能的基础上,本文提出了一种基于竞争窗口动态自适应调整的算法。该算法首先采用时隙利用率因子估计网络当前负载状况,然后在不同优先级下根据时隙利用率动态调整竞争窗口,降低了信道接入的竞争,提高了网络的性能。仿真实验表明,该算法在保证实时业务要求的同时,能够有效降低时延,显著提高无线局域网的吞吐量。

关 键 词:服务质量;增强型分布式协调功能;竞争窗口;时隙利用率
